On Tuesday, the girls’ basketball team won 59-43 in the Central League Championship against Haverford.
During the first quarter, Haverford was in the lead against Conestoga 16-10. Conestoga made three fouls, and Haverford made two.
In the second quarter, ’Stoga played one foul and Haverford played two. By halftime, Conestoga had caught up and the score was tied 26-26.
During the third quarter, Conestoga made three fouls and so did Haverford. In the last few seconds of the third quarter, Conestoga scored a basket.
In the fourth and final quarter, multiple timeouts were called. Haverford made another two fouls allowing Conestoga to make free throws to finish up the game and secure its victory. At the end of the fourth quarter, Conestoga won against Haverford with a score of 59-43.
